What companies run services between Trieste, Italy and Taggia, Italy?

You can take a train from Trieste Centrale to Taggia via Cervignano-Aquil.-Gr, Venezia Mestre, Genova P.Za Principe, and Taggia Arma in around 9h 17m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Trieste Central Bus Station to Taggia via Bologna Autostazione, Bologna - Piazza Xx Settembre, Piazza Colombo - Sanremo, and San Remo - Autostazione in around 11h 55m.
